
"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ene of Georgia, a once-loyal supporter of President Donald Trump who has become a critic, said Friday she is resigning from Congress in January. Greene, in a more than 10-minute video posted online, explained her decision and said she's "always been despised in Washington, D.C., and just never fit in." Greene's resignation followed a public fallout with Trump in recent months, as the congresswoman criticized him for his stance on files related to Jeffrey Epstein, along with foreign policy and healthcare."
"In her video, she underscored her longtime loyalty to Trump except on a few issues, and said it was "unfair and wrong" that he attacked her for disagreeing. "Loyalty should be a two-way street and we should be able to vote our conscience and represent our district's interest, because our job title is literally 'representative,'" she said. Greene swept to office at the forefront of Trump's "Make America Great Again" movement and swiftly became a lightning rod on Capitol Hill for her often beyond-mainstream views."
Marjorie Taylor Greene announced she will resign from Congress with her last day on January 5, 2026. The resignation followed a public breakdown with former ally President Donald Trump after Greene criticized his stance on Jeffrey Epstein files, foreign policy, and healthcare. Trump called her a "traitor" and "wacky" and said he would back a primary challenger. Greene said she had long been loyal to Trump but insisted loyalty must be reciprocal and representatives must vote their conscience. Greene rose to prominence as a leading MAGA figure, embraced QAnon and controversial associations, and later aligned with GOP leaders as an effective legislator.
